According to the agency, heavy smoke was observed in the apartment on the 5th floor.

It is noted that 22 residents of the house were able to evacuate on their own before the arrival of firefighters.

According to preliminary data, the emergency operation of electrical equipment could become the cause of the fire.

Major General Alexander Markov, the head of the regional department of the department, arrived at the scene.

Earlier, the Ministry of Emergencies called faulty wiring the most common cause of a fire in residential buildings in Russia.

In September, the FAN reported that in Russia more than 400 children die annually in fires.
